    If the snow surface gets wet and sticky on Friday, think about wet avalanches on slopes over 35 degrees. You can try to push on the snow on small test slopes to see if it is “ripe” and ready to slide downhill. You can also get off your mode of travel and step into the snow to see if you are sinking in past your ankle. If so, you will know there is enough heavy snow to create a Wet Loose avalanche. These slides often start at a point before fanning out as they descend downhill. Look for recent fan-shaped debris piles or fresh rollerballs and pinwheels as visual clues to help you identify that these slides are possible.

Avalanche Discussion

Cloudy weather should battle with springtime temperatures in an attempt to soften the snow surface on Friday. Without the aid of sunshine, we suspect that the cloudy weather should win and help to keep wet avalanches at bay. Taking note of the snow surface throughout the day can help you make terrain decisions and set the tone for your time in the mountains. If you find that the surface is firm and mostly supportable, the avalanche hazard should be minimal. If you are plunging in deeply on a poorly frozen surface, the likelihood of you triggering a Wet Loose avalanche, or cornices and blocks of snow falling from rocky ledges may have increased.

The snowpack at Snoqualmie Pass is still in a state of transition toward its springtime form. It may take a few more freeze/thaw cycles before we can put deeper layers to bed completely and focus on the diurnal nature of the snowpack. Until this happens, continue to think about the weak snow grains above the Early March Crust (~3 feet below the surface) on upper elevation shaded slopes. The last avalanche on this layer was on 3/18 at Snoqualmie Pass, but there was a very large avalanche suspected to have failed on this layer during a bout of warm weather in the West North zone on Wednesday, 3/23. We do not have any layers of concern below the Early March Crust at this time.
